The Mexican Slow Cooker by Deborah Schneider

This was a gift from a student and I was so excited to receive it. I've read it cover to cover and I feel like I have a really good understanding of all the different kinds of peppers and how to use them. That's good right?? I was under the assumption that because the recipes were in a slow cooker that they would be pretty easy. Well turns out most of the recipes are very involved. That's not a bad thing but I just have to make sure I only do those recipes on days when I have more time. I made a verde chicken soup and shredded chicken tacos so far and WOW they were delicious!! Schneider is big on making everything from scratch so I plan on trying to make my own stock from her recipe soon.
